How much do on call division laundry j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 17, 2026, the average hourly pay for on call division laundry in the United States is $17.12,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.42 and $17.55 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How you will make a difference(Job Overview):

The Recovery Counselor is a para-professional treatment team member who is responsible for providing direct care to meet the physical and psychosocial needs of the clients through direct and indirect physical and verbal interaction. Ensure that all safety regulations are followed, and the facilities are maintained in a safe and clean manner. Assist with client laundry, household cleaning and other tasks as needed. This position performs a variety of tasks to ensure that the facility is in a clean, orderly, sanitary, and attractive condition. Duties are performed under direct supervision of the Program Manager, or designee in most cases, but some tasks are accomplished independently.

Division/Program Overview:

  • 16-bed facilities

  • Designed for adults with mental health challenges or a recent crisis who need intensive treatment.

  • 24/7 programs as an alternative to urgent care or hospitalization.

  • Individuals can live on-site in a homelike setting for a short term while they receive counseling and learn basic living and interpersonal skills.

  • Able to receive physical and psychological evaluation, mental health, and case management services, in addition to assistance locating permanent housing.
